Monarchs Best Rangers in Opener

Results
WILKES-BARRE, Pa.. (October 28, 2011) – The Drew women's swim team opened up their 2011-12 campaign with a 101-87 loss at the hands of Kings College (1-0) earlier this evening.  Sophomore Mariel Schwinger (Los Angeles Calif./Sherman Oaks) won two individual races for Head Coach Eric Scheingoltz's squad.

Schwinger was  a high point for Drew (0-1) as she took first in both the 500 freestyle and the 1000 freestyle. She finished the 500 with a time of 5:35.77 and turned in a time of  11:29.04 in the 1000. Classmate Alexa Morrissey (Brooklyn, N.Y./Fontbonne Hall Academy) was the only other Ranger to place first in an individual event. The sophomore turned in a time of 58.22 in the 100 freestyle eclipsing her personal best by .02

The Rangers will be back in the pool in their home opener on Saturday when they welcome Ramapo to the F.M. Kirby Pool. First event is set to start at 2:00 p.m.
